Stephan Erasmus

Johannesburg

SHREDDED (2015)

Type of book work: Unique / sculptural book-object (one-of-a-kind)
Dimensions: varies
Media: Digital Print on paper

Artist's / designer's statements

Erasmus is an artist based in Johannesburg, He works with the manipulation of text into a visual format.

The book is a set of 5 frames, with each frame containing a selection of shredded text. Due to the framing size the shredded sheets create a horizontal line.





SELECTED STRATAGEMS FOR A SORROWFUL GAME (2015)

Type of book work: Editioned / printed work
Dimensions: 150 x 290 x 10 closed
Media: Digital Print on archival paper with Belgium secret binding

Artist's / designer's statements

Due to his use of text and the encryption of the text the works fits well into the production of artists' books.

The book contain images that resembles diagrams drawn in planning a football match.
